What are the Benefits of Industrial Sandblasting?

Industrial sandblasting, also called abrasive blasting, removes mill scale, oxidation, and contaminants to create a controlled anchor profile on metal. This process is essential for compliance with NACE/SSPC standards, ensuring that protective coatings achieve maximum mechanical bond strength and corrosion resistance in extreme Canadian climates.

Precision Sandblasting Process for Alberta’s Energy Sector

Our process follows a strict quality control workflow:

  1. Surface inspection for grease and salts
  2. Selective abrasive blasting using garnet media to achieve a 2.0–4.0 mil profile
  3. Dust removal via high-CFM collection
  4. NACE-certified inspection prior to immediate coating application to prevent flash rust

Why We Use Garnet Abrasives

In the Canadian industrial sector, efficiency and safety are non-negotiable. We utilize garnet over traditional slags for five reasons:

PropertyDescription
HardnessGarnet effectively removes rust, paint, and old coatings during sandblasting services without damaging metal surfaces.
Abrasive EfficiencyIts abrasive properties prepare surfaces thoroughly, ensuring coatings adhere properly for long-lasting results in sandblasting and coating or sandblasting and painting.
VersatilityGarnet’s range of particle sizes allows it to handle everything from heavy-duty material removal to fine surface finishing in industrial sandblasting applications.
Chemically InertBeing chemically stable, garnet minimizes reactions with surfaces or coatings, providing a safe and controlled environment for sandblasting services.
Cost-EffectiveGarnet delivers high-quality surface preparation while offering excellent value for industrial sandblasting projects.

FAQ about Sandblasting Company in Alberta

What surface profile can you achieve?

We typically achieve a 2.0 to 4.5 mil anchor profile depending on the abrasive mesh and pressure settings, tailored to your specific coating TDS.

Do you comply with NACE SSPC-SP 5?

Yes. We provide SP 5 white metal and SP 10 near-white metal blasting for critical service assets requiring the highest level of cleanliness.

Can you handle winter projects?

Yes. Our 10,000 SF Sherwood Park facility is fully climate-controlled, allowing us to maintain the substrate temperatures required to avoid flash rust and meet coating windows during Alberta winters.
